unit neon;
{$mode delphi}
{$H+}

interface
uses
Classes, SysUtils, SimdUtils;
procedure flt2byte(flts: TFloat32s; byts: TUInt8s; lMin, lMax: single; skipVx: int64);
procedure int2byte(lMin, lMax: single; ints: TInt16s; byts: TUInt8s; skipVx: int64; SSE: boolean = true);
implementation
{$L ./aarch64-darwin/scale2uint8.o}
function f32_i8sse(in32: pointer; out8: pointer; n: int64; mn, mx: single): Integer; external name '__Z9f32_i8ssePfPhxff';
function i16_i8sse(in16: pointer; out8: pointer; n: int64; mn, mx: single): Integer; external name '__Z9i16_i8ssePsPhxff';
Type
ByteRA0 = array [0..MAXINT] of byte;
Bytep0 = ^ByteRA0;
IntRA0 = array [0..MAXINT] of int16;
Intp0 = ^IntRA0;
FltRA0 = array [0..MAXINT] of single;
Fltp0 = ^FltRA0;
procedure int2byteSISD(lMin, lMax: single; ints: Intp0; byts: Bytep0; skipVx, nVx: int64);
var
i: int64;
slope: single;
begin
slope := abs(lMax - lMin);
if slope > 0 then
slope := 255.0/slope;
for i := 0 to (nVx - 1) do begin
if (ints[skipVx+i] >= lMax) then
byts[i] := 255
else if (ints[skipVx+i] <= lMin) then
byts[i] := 0
else
byts[i] := round((ints[skipVx+i] - lMin) * slope);
end;
end;
procedure int2byte(lMin, lMax: single; ints: TInt16s; byts: TUInt8s; skipVx: int64; SSE: boolean = true);
const
kAlign = 16; //Neon expects values aligned to 16-byte boundaries
kInBytes = 2;
kVectorSize = 16; //Neon will retire 128 bytes (16x8-bit) values at a time
var
inAlign: PtrUint;
head: int64 = 0;
tail: int64 = 0;
nVox: int64;
begin
nVox := length(byts);
if (lMin = lMax) then lMin -= 1E-9;
//check output alignment (required)
inAlign := PtrUint(@byts[0]) mod kAlign;
if (lMin >= lMax) or (inAlign <> 0) or (nVox < (kVectorSize * 3)) then
SSE := false;
if (SSE) then begin //check input alignment, scalar required items to align
inAlign := PtrUint(@ints[skipVx]) mod kAlign;
if (inAlign <> 0) and ((inAlign mod kInBytes) <> 0) then
SSE := false
else if (inAlign <> 0) then begin
head := (kAlign - inAlign) div kInBytes;
int2byteSISD(lMin,lMax, @ints[0],@byts[0], skipVx, head);
skipVx += head;
nVox -= head;
end;
end;
if (SSE) and ((nVox mod kVectorSize) <> 0) then begin
tail := (nVox mod kVectorSize);
int2byteSISD(lMin,lMax, @ints[0],@byts[nVox-tail+head], skipVx+nVox-tail, tail);
nVox -= tail;
end;
//function i16_i8sse(in16: pointer; out8: pointer; n: int64; mn, mx: single): Integer; external name '__Z9f32_i8ssePfPhxff';
if SSE then
i16_i8sse(@ints[skipVx],@byts[head],nVox, lMin,lMax)
else
int2byteSISD(lMin,lMax, @ints[0],@byts[0], skipVx, length(byts));
end;
procedure flt2byteSISD(lMin, lMax: single; flts: Fltp0; byts: Bytep0; skipVx, nVx: int64);
var
i: int64;
slope: single;
begin
slope := abs(lMax - lMin);
if slope > 0 then
slope := 255.0/slope;
for i := 0 to (nVx - 1) do begin
if (flts[skipVx+i] >= lMax) then
byts[i] := 255
else if (flts[skipVx+i] <= lMin) then
byts[i] := 0
else
byts[i] := round((flts[skipVx+i] - lMin) * slope);
end;
end;
procedure flt2byte(flts: TFloat32s; byts: TUInt8s; lMin, lMax: single; skipVx: int64);
const
kAlign = 16; //Neon expects values aligned to 16-byte boundaries
kInBytes = 2;
kVectorSize = 16; //Neon will retire 128 bytes (16x8-bit) values at a time
var
inAlign: PtrUint;
SSE : boolean = true;
head: int64 = 0;
tail: int64 = 0;
nVox: int64;
begin
nVox := length(byts);
if (lMin = lMax) then lMin -= 1E-9;
//check output alignment (required)
inAlign := PtrUint(@byts[0]) mod kAlign;
if (lMin >= lMax) or (inAlign <> 0) or (nVox < (kVectorSize * 3)) then
SSE := false;
if (SSE) then begin //check input alignment, scalar required items to align
inAlign := PtrUint(@flts[skipVx]) mod kAlign;
if (inAlign <> 0) and ((inAlign mod kInBytes) <> 0) then
SSE := false
else if (inAlign <> 0) then begin
head := (kAlign - inAlign) div kInBytes;
flt2byteSISD(lMin,lMax, @flts[0],@byts[0], skipVx, head);
skipVx += head;
nVox -= head;
end;
end;
if (SSE) and ((nVox mod kVectorSize) <> 0) then begin
tail := (nVox mod kVectorSize);
//writeln('>>>', nVox, 'x', tail, ':',ints[skipVx+nVox-tail]);
flt2byteSISD(lMin,lMax, @flts[0],@byts[nVox-tail+head], skipVx+nVox-tail, tail);
//byts[nVox-tail] := 127;
nVox -= tail;
end;
if SSE then begin
f32_i8sse(@flts[skipVx],@byts[head],nVox, lMin,lMax)
end else
flt2byteSISD(lMin,lMax, @flts[0],@byts[0], skipVx, length(byts));
end;
end.
